How they compare

Chile currently reports -18.89 billion against -37.80 billion in Indonesia, a difference of 18.91 billion.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Chile ahead.

Chile ranks 29th and Indonesia ranks 32nd of 39 countries.

Chile has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Chile Indonesia Difference Ahead
2000s -12.78 billion -13.79 billion 1.01 billion Chile
2010s -12.08 billion -28.54 billion 16.46 billion Chile
2020s -16.72 billion -34.45 billion 17.73 billion Chile

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The OECD Economic Outlook presents the OECD’s analysis of the major global economic trends and prospects for the next two years. The Outlook puts forward a consistent set of projections for output, employment, government spending, prices and current balances based on a review of each member country and of the induced effect on each of them on international developments.
